Word Round

  • Over the last two years, stand-up poet Rob Gee went into a variety of inpatient psychiatric settings around Nottingham, Northampton, Kettering and Leicester to compose poems with groups of patients. He would act as scribe, while people in the room contributed ideas, jokes, lines and rhymes. This book is a selection of those poems.

    Featuring poems from inpatients in acute, elderly, forensic, intensive care, child/adolescent, eating disorders, learning disability, and rehabilitation/supported care settings.

    The art work featured in this collection was created by BrightSparks Arts in Mental Health workshop participants at the Bradgate Unit.
